Maker of Heaven and Earth . . .

January 30, 2013 Length: 51:08

In this episode, Dr. Kariatlis investigates the meaning of the phrase "maker of heaven and earth, and of all things visible and invisible," endeavouring to explain why these words were incorporated into the Creed. He then gives a basic outline of the Orthodox teaching on creation, raising some of the more important aspects of the doctrine and reflecting on its significance for us today.
